Easton Express May 10, 1963 p. 21

William *F. Freytag, 44, of Dallas, Texas, formerly of Easton, was stricken fatally with a heart attack Saturday while attending a dinner at a Dallas hotel.

Mr. Freytag was a son of Mrs. Elsie Freytag of Easton and the late William Freytag. He was a graduate of Easton High School, class of 1936.

He was vice president of Borg-Warner Acceptance Corp. and co-owner of Gould-Massey Employment Service in Dallas.

He left Easton about 12 years ago and moved to Clifton, N.J. He resided in Dallas since 1955.

Dallas Morning News (TX), May 5, 1963, Section 1, page 22

William. S. Freytag

Funeral services and entombment for William S. Freytag, 44, of 6110 Averill Way, vice-president of the B. W. Acceptance Corp., will be held at 2 p.m. Monday in the Hillcrest Mausoleum.

Mr. Freytag, who died here Friday, had been a Dallas resident since 1955. He was also co-owner of the Gould-Massey Employment Service.

Survivors: Wife; a daughter, Miss Lynn Freytag of Clifton, N.J., and mother, Mrs. Elsie Freytag of Easton, Pa.
